Located at the Bowmanville Cement Plant, the Human Resources Generalist is an on-site Human Resources contact for plant employees, supervisors and managers. Reporting to the Human Resources Manager, this role provides day-to-day support across employee and labour relations, recruitment and onboarding, performance management, attendance and disability management, training coordination, HR systems and records administration. The Human Resources Generalist partners closely with plant leadership, union representatives, Corporate Human Resources, Payroll and Safety to support a safe, respectful, compliant and productive workplace. WHAT WILL YOU DO? Serves as an advisor to plant leaders on applicable Ontario employment and labour legislation, collective agreement requirements, Company policies, ethical and workplace issues, employee relations and progressive discipline. Develops and maintains an effective department work environment and creates and promotes harmonious working relationships with other departments and employees. Coaches and supports managers and supervisors on all processes of performance management to ensure that they are understood and being used. Provides front-line support for employee and labour relations matters, including workplace concerns, investigations, grievance administration and preparation of documentation in accordance with the collective agreement and Company policy. Builds constructive working relationships with union representatives and supports the Human Resources Manager and plant leadership with labour relations activities and collective bargaining preparation, as required. Partners with plant leadership and Safety to reinforce safe-work expectations, support safety-related communications and training, and address people-related matters that may affect workplace health and safety. Supports hourly and salaried recruitment for the plant, including job postings, interview coordination, candidate communication, pre-employment requirements and onboarding. Supports attendance, accommodation, disability and return-to-work processes in partnership with employees, leaders and applicable internal or external partners. Maintains accurate employee, position and organizational data in SAP, Dayforce, Kronos and other HR systems, and provides regular and ad hoc workforce reporting to plant and HR leadership. Provides guidance and training to managers and supervisors on interviewing, hiring, onboarding, performance management, progressive discipline and termination processes. Liaises with local and Corporate Human Resources in the administration of payroll, benefits programs, pension plans, and all HR policies and procedures. Liaises with Payroll for compensation and benefits to ensure required forms are accurately documented. Maintains department related information for monthly and quarterly reporting requirements and prepares data as requested on a routine and ad hoc basis. Assist with all internal and external HR related inquiries or requests. Maintain and ensure that employee records are updated as necessary and are accurate. Maintains the HRIS system (SAP) ensuring accurate data input and integrity are maintained. Assists with Temp to Full-Time conversions (notifications, letters, onboarding paperwork and scheduling and preparing for orientation sessions) Processes all new hire paperwork, IT forms, and onboarding. Assists department with administrative needs. Maintains and updates employee communication. Department filing and scanning compliance. Assists with coordinating annual and one-time facility-wide events. Coordinates company sponsored programs. Assists with facilitating company bereavement, service award and tuition reimbursement programs. Ensures Company’s HR processes are supported and administered in a timely basis including but not limited to, BSC scorecard development, bonus payout, merit increases, employee development (SDV & IDP), climate survey. Coordinates plant training on legislated and Company requirements, including workplace harassment and violence prevention, employment standards, human rights, accessibility and other mandatory training. Responds to inquiries regarding policies, procedures and programs. WHAT DO YOU NEED TO SUCCEED?
